powershell-2025-changes

Community

Navigate PowerShell's 2025 evolution.

AuthorJosiahSiegel
Version1.0.0
Installs0

System Documentation

What problem does it solve?

This Skill helps users understand and migrate away from deprecated PowerShell features and modules that will cease to function in 2025, ensuring script compatibility and security.

Core Features & Use Cases

  • Identify Deprecations: Details the removal of PowerShell 2.0, MSOnline, AzureAD modules, and WMIC.
  • Migration Guidance: Provides code examples for transitioning to modern alternatives like Microsoft.Graph, PSResourceGet, and CIM cmdlets.
  • Security Best Practices: Outlines the adoption of JEA, WDAC, and Constrained Language Mode for enhanced security.
  • Use Case: A system administrator needs to update legacy PowerShell scripts that rely on the MSOnline module. This Skill provides the exact commands to switch to the Microsoft.Graph module, ensuring the scripts continue to function after the MSOnline retirement.

Quick Start

Use the powershell-2025-changes skill to understand the migration path from the MSOnline module to Microsoft.Graph.

Dependency Matrix

Required Modules

None required

Components

references

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: powershell-2025-changes
Download link: https://github.com/JosiahSiegel/claude-plugin-marketplace/archive/main.zip#powershell-2025-changes

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.